Composition, Technique & the Art Deco Era:
The most striking aspect is its bold stepped motif, a hallmark of the Art Deco movement — a global design style that emerged in the 1920s and flourished into the 1930s. Art Deco celebrated luxury, modernism, and progress, often expressed through clean lines, geometric patterns, and lavish materials.
This knocker and slot cover epitomize that vision — the precise angular shapes and symmetrical design reflect the era’s fascination with order, technology, and elegance. Cast in robust brass and finished with a now-aged layer of gold paint, the piece showcases exceptional detailing and durable artistry meant to last generations.
